A primer on pitchfork bifurcation.


Gabriel Nagy
Department of Mathematics
UCSD

Abstract

We present a brief description of a bifurcation of a solution curve of an equation in a Banach space. We focus on pitchfork type of bifurcations, and we present a sufficient a condition for their existence. We will discuss these ideas in a particular example, which consists in the study of equilibrium configurations of a toroidal fluid. We will finally comment on the stability of the solutions curves in a neighborhood of a bifurcation point.
